在MATLAB gui界面中如何把数据输出到sql server的表格中
时间: 2023-07-16 08:15:04 浏览: 156
matlab 连接数据库以及导出数据库数据CSV格式
要在MATLAB GUI界面中将数据输出到SQL Server的表格中,您需要使用MATLAB Database Toolbox提供的函数和工具。下面是一个简单的示例:
1. 首先,您需要使用Database Explorer连接到SQL Server数据库,并选择要将数据输出到其中的表格。
2. 在MATLAB中,使用Database Toolbox的函数建立到SQL Server的连接,例如:
```
conn = database('database_name','username','password','Vendor','Microsoft SQL Server','Server','server_name');
```
这将创建一个名为`conn`的连接对象,允许您与SQL Server数据库进行交互。
3. 然后,您可以使用MATLAB中的数据存储结构(如表格或数组)来存储您要输出到表格中的数据。例如,以下代码将创建一个名为`data`的表格:
```
data = table([1;2;3],[4;5;6],'VariableNames',{'Column1','Column2'});
```
4. 最后,使用`insert`函数将数据插入到SQL Server表格中。例如,以下代码将数据插入到名为`table_name`的表格中:
```
tablename = 'table_name';
colnames = {'Column1','Column2'};
datainsert(conn,tablename,colnames,data);
```
这将插入`data`表格中的数据到SQL Server表格中,并使用`colnames`指定要插入的列名称。
请注意,这只是一个简单的示例,您需要根据您的实际需求进行修改和调整。同时,确保您已经安装了MATLAB Database Toolbox并连接到正确的SQL Server数据库。
阅读全文